Does G-10 ever wear out, the texture and stuff or lose its color? Also, does the BP coating on the blade wear off if you cut through those stupid plastic packages that they store toys in?

No, No, and Yes...G-10 will not wear down easily...I have never heard of a case where G-10 wore down or lost its color, it will get dirty, but you cna clean it easily...Now, ANY and ALL blade coatign swill eventually wear out though, and yes it will happen faster when cutign through plactic like those toy packages...But, some coatings hold out better than others, I just don't know whcih is which...I usually dont liek knives with coated blades...but I made an exception with my latest D2 Griptilian because the coating helps to protect the D2...But I hate the way coating looks all worn on a blade...

I own a minimal of plastic handled knives, i more so prefer wood, animal horn/bone or metal. But im glad the G-10 wont wear down. How do you clean it without ruining it? I also didnt get the delica because it didnt fit well in my hand. Just felt like a 10$ knife.
 
G-10 is tough stuff, when it gets dirty all you need to do is wipe it down with a damp cloth...If it gets dirty enough soap and water works fine...It really is very low maintenance...
